Informatics Point

Информатика и проектирование

Разработка алгоритма и графа макрооперации

Схема алгоритма работы СВУ представлена на рис 1.2. Если р=1, то СВУ начинает работать, в противном случае СВУ находится в режиме ожидания. Далее осуществляется проверка условия -128ЈЈХЈЈ127. Если условие выполнено, то далее следуют операции умножения, сложения, деления, логического сложения, выдача результатов и конец схемы алгоритма. В противном случае необходимо произвести остановку СВУ (прерывание) и выйти на конец алгоритма. Потом произвести масштабирование исходных данных и вернуться на начало алгоритма.

Для того чтобы показать информационные связи в алгоритме и наметить перечень функциональных элементов СВУ исходная макрооперация представляется в виде графа алгоритма с операциями деления и умножения на рис.1.3.

Рис.1.2 Cхема алгоритма работы СВУ

2 2 8

Рис.1.3 Граф алгоритма макрооперации с операциями умножения и деления

Заменив операции деления на арифметический сдвиг вправо, получим граф алгоритма макрооперации изображенной на рис.1.4.

Рис.1.4 Граф алгоритма макрооперации с операциями сдвигов

По виду графа алгоритма составляется упрощённая функциональная схема СВУ (рис.1.5).

Регистры Р1, Р2, РЗ служат для хранения данных A, B, C соответственно, которые представлены в дополнительном коде. Операция сложения осуществляется в сумматоре накапливающего типа.

Рис.1.5 Упрощённая функциональная схема без управляющих сигналов

В накапливающий сумматор входит 8-разрядный комбинационный сумматор и 8-разрядный регистр сумматора (РСМ). Арифметические сдвиги влево осуществляются в сдвигающем регистре сумматора. Операция логического сложения осуществляется с помощью логического элемента «ИЛИ».

Лучшие статьи по информатике

Обзор программных средств локальных сетей
С распространением ЭВМ нетрудно предсказать рост в потребности передачи данных. Некоторые приложения, которые нуждаются в системах связи, могу ...

Модернизация схемы блока управления для привода Fm-Stepdrive фирмы siemens с целью расширения функциональных возможностей
История развития бытовой и промышленной микропроцессорной аппаратуры тесно связана с развитием средств ЭВТ. За время своего развития средства ЭВТ прошли ...

Проектирование микропроцессорного устройства
Спроектировать микропроцессорное устройство содержащее МП, системный контроллер, адресные буферы, ОЗУ, ПЗУ, порт ввода/вывода, адресный дешифратор. ...

Меню сайта